Explain the Skeletal System?
Skeletal System: The support framework, or skeleton, in the human body is composed of mostly hard mineral substances. Unlike crustaceans or insects who possess external skeletons (exoskeletons), humans have internal skeletons, or endoskeletons.
The human skeleton is divided into two parts, the axial skeleton and the appendicular skeleton. The axial skeleton includes the spine; the ribs; the sacrum, five united vertebrae at the end of the spinal column; the sternum or breastbone; and the cranium, or braincase. The appendicular skeleton contains 126 bones, including those of the arms, legs (the appendages), pelvis, and shoulders.
In addition functioning in locomotion, bones serve as mineral storage reservoirs and as protective cages -- the cranium protects the delicate brain tissue, ribs protect lungs, heart and other internal organs, and the backbone protects the spinal cord.
